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.
| Model | Per session | Once invoked |
|---|---|---|
| Fable 5.1 | $0.00062 | $0.00674 |
| Opus 5 | $0.00031 | $0.00337 |
| Sonnet 5 | $0.00012 | $0.00135 |
| Haiku 4.5 | $0.00006 | $0.00067 |

AARRR Funnel Analysis
For each stage, define metric, current performance, and optimization lever:
| Stage | Primary Metric | Key Optimization Lever |
|---|---|---|
| Acquisition | CAC, channel conversion rate | Channel mix, targeting, messaging |
| Activation | % users reaching "aha moment" | Onboarding flow, time-to-value |
| Retention | D1/D7/D30 retention, churn rate | Habit loops, notifications, value |
| Referral | k-factor, NPS, sharing rate | Incentive design, viral loops |
| Revenue | LTV, ARPU, conversion to paid | Pricing, upsell, expansion revenue |
Viral Coefficient (k-factor)
k = i × c
where:
-
i= average invitations sent per user -
c= conversion rate of invitations to new users -
k > 1.0: viral growth (each user brings > 1 new user on average)
-
k = 0.5-1.0: strong word-of-mouth component
-
k < 0.2: minimal virality, paid acquisition dominant
To improve k: increase i (make sharing easier, incentivize) or increase c (improve landing page, social proof).
Activation Optimization
- Define the "aha moment" — the action that correlates with long-term retention
- Measure time-to-aha for cohorts
- Remove every step between signup and aha moment
- Build progressive onboarding: immediate value → deferred complexity
- A/B test onboarding variations with activation rate as primary metric
